TERMINALIA (TERMINALIA ARJUNA) is the herb of choice in Ayurvedic medicine for cardiovascular health. Arjuna supports healthy heart function, lipid metabolism, has antioxidant properties, and promotes healthy prostaglandin levels. Its principal constituents are β – sitosterol, ellagic acid, and arjunic acid.
TRIBULUS (TRIBULUS TERRESTRIS) has been used traditionally for fluid retention and as anantiseptic and anti-inflammatory. Additional uses have been to support liver, kidney, and cardiovascular health. Current use is often for support of sexual function and fertility. Tribulus terrestris has smooth muscle-relaxant properties, which explain its benefit on sexual function and its blood pressure regulating properties.
CORDYCEPS (CORDYCEPS SINENSIS) supports the healthy regulation of PHF (Parathyroid Hypertensive Factor). Healthy PHF levels support healthy intracellular calcium levels, which support healthy blood pressure.
RAUWOLFIA SERPENTINA contains the alkaloid reserpine. Rauwolfia serpentina has been shown to be an effective blood-pressure-lowering agent. Rauwolfia serpentina’s alkaloids relax the nervous system by reduction of sympathetic dominance. This effect is mediated by removal of noradrenaline and prevention of reabsorption at the noradrenergic nerve ending. Rauwolfia serpentina may have selective noradrenaline reuptake inhibitor properties.
